Originally rated March 2006. Says it is brewed by Silver Creek Brewery, Wisconsin and has a 7% ABV written on the label... even though this was bought at The Beer Store in Canada. This malt liquor pours a clean yellow-gold colour with a good white fizzy-cream head. Retention is under medium and some lace is left. Active average-size bubble carbonation. The nose is a bad mix between alcohol and metal. Wow, this is bad ! Not even good corn taste, but watery malt with mild aftertaste of apples. Alcohol is present in the flavour, but no burn, really light. Badly brewed, I suggest for malt liquor to stick with Mongoose in the can.
